2 Kings 3:15-23
English Standard Version
Chapter 3
15But now bring me a musician." And when the musician played, the hand of the Lord came upon him. 16And he said, "Thus says the Lord, ‘I will make this dry streambed full of pools.’ 17For thus says the Lord, ‘You shall not see wind or rain, but that streambed shall be filled with water, so that you shall drink, you, your livestock, and your animals.’ 18This is a light thing in the sight of the Lord. He will also give the Moabites into your hand, 19and you shall attack every fortified city and every choice city, and shall fell every good tree and stop up all springs of water and ruin every good piece of land with stones." 20The next morning, about the time of offering the sacrifice, behold, water came from the direction of Edom, till the country was filled with water.
21When all the Moabites heard that the kings had come up to fight against them, all who were able to put on armor, from the youngest to the oldest, were called out and were drawn up at the border.
22And when they rose early in the morning and the sun shone on the water, the Moabites saw the water opposite them as red as blood.
23And they said, "This is blood; the kings have surely fought together and struck one another down. Now then, Moab, to the spoil!"
